What Makes Adhesives Food Safe

Food-safe adhesives are designed with specific criteria in mind to ensure they do not leach harmful substances into food or beverages. Regulatory bodies set strict guidelines that these adhesives must meet, focusing on non-toxicity and the ability to withstand various environmental conditions without breaking down. This means that when evaluating what glue works best for paper straws, one must consider not only its bonding strength but also its compliance with safety regulations.

Key Ingredients in Safe Glues

The composition of food-grade adhesives includes ingredients that are generally recognized as safe (GRAS) by health authorities. Common components may include natural resins, starches, and modified cellulose that provide strong bonds while remaining non-toxic. Understanding these key ingredients helps manufacturers develop products that align with consumer demands for safe and sustainable packaging solutions.

Common Types of Food-Grade Adhesives

There are several types of food-grade adhesives available on the market today, each suited for different applications including bonding paper straws. Water-based adhesives are popular due to their low toxicity and ease of use; they dry clear and provide a solid bond without compromising safety standards. Other options include hot melt adhesives and pressure-sensitive varieties, each offering unique benefits depending on the specific requirements of your project.

Testing for Non-Toxicity

When we talk about what glue works best for paper straws, non-toxicity is non-negotiable! Consumers want peace of mind knowing that their drinks won’t come with a side of harmful chemicals. Therefore, rigorous testing must be done to ensure that any food-grade adhesive used in manufacturing paper straws meets safety standards set by regulatory bodies.

Non-toxic adhesives often undergo assessments like migration tests to determine if any harmful substances leach into food or beverages over time. This step is essential because even trace amounts of toxic compounds can pose health risks. Comparing Performance with Various Adhesives

Now comes the fun part: comparing different food-grade adhesives to find out which one reigns supreme in the world of paper straws! Some popular contenders include water-based glues and hot melt adhesives—each boasting unique benefits tailored to specific applications.

Water-based glues are typically favored due to their lower environmental impact and ease of use; they dry clear and maintain flexibility over time. On the other hand, hot melt adhesives offer quick setting times but may not always provide the same level of non-toxicity as their water-based counterparts. Step-by-Step Application Guide

First things first, gather your materials: food-grade adhesive, paper straws, a clean workspace, and any additional tools like brushes or spatulas for spreading glue. Start by shaking or stirring the adhesive to ensure an even consistency; this is crucial for achieving a strong bond. Apply a thin layer of glue to one surface of your paper straw using your tool of choice—less is often more when it comes to food-grade adhesives!

Next, press the glued surfaces together firmly but gently; excessive force can cause warping or tearing of the paper. Allow adequate time for drying as per the manufacturer’s instructions; patience is key here! Finally, inspect your work to ensure there are no gaps or weak spots—after all, you want those straws holding up against liquids without compromising safety.

Trends in Eco-Friendly Glue Technology

One of the most exciting trends in eco-friendly glue technology is the shift towards bio-based adhesives derived from renewable resources. These food-grade adhesives are formulated to minimize environmental impact while maintaining strong bonding capabilities. Additionally, innovations such as water-based formulations are gaining traction because they reduce harmful emissions and enhance safety when considering what glue works best for paper straws.

Another trend is the increased use of natural polymers like starch and cellulose in adhesive production. These materials not only provide effective bonding but also align with sustainability goals by being biodegradable and non-toxic. The rise of these alternatives reflects a broader movement within industries to embrace greener practices without sacrificing quality or performance.
